Church Conversion Home For Sale in Tennessee
Originally built in 1970 to be the worship center for a local body of believers, this church-conversion building has been gutted and re-designed to maximize space and comfort.The building features a Brick and Stone Exterior and has a total footprint of 5700 sq. ft.
The current owners have taken a portion of the interior space and created a spacious double car garage with insulated doors, decorative aluminum trim on the interior, and enough additional space for a workshop area or to store tools and/or equipment.
Attention to detail has been given to all the selections to ensure uniqueness and timelessness.
Upon entering the dwelling, you will be amazed at the rustic charm and character that this property has to offer. Expansive open area with a large enough space to entertain guests, dance, or whatever your heart desires.
The space additionally features a large sitting area, dining room, and enclosed office, study, or library room which is accented by an exterior brick wall and french doors.
There are 2 primary bedroom suites, with adjoining bathrooms and walk-in closets.
All the bathrooms in the home feature spacious walk-in showers, updated vanities, lighting, flooring, and plumbing fixtures. In addition to the primary bedroom suites, there are two remaining bedroom nooks with common area in between, and both featuring ample closet spaces. There is also an upstairs loft which could be used for a sleeping area, or upstairs sitting or recreational space. This home also features a spacious laundry room with a 3rd guest bathroom attached, that also showcases a custom built walk-in tile shower. A covered front porch has been added for extra delight.
About the Area - Bradford, Tennessee
The property is nestled on a spacious lot consisting of approximately 1.4 acres in Bradford, Tennessee and features public utility services such as sewer and water. There is an expansive circle driveway in front, and a storm-shelter built into the side of the hill near the house.Bradford features an award winning school system and offers small classroom sizes and quality extracurricular school activities such as FFA, Beta, and competitive academic and sports programs.
Bradford Tennessee is located approximately halfway between Memphis, and Nashville, TN, on US HWY 45, approximately 25 miles north of Interstate 40, Exit Ramp 80B.
The University of Tennessee at Martin is only about a 25 minute commute to the North, and Union University, Jackson State Community College, and University of Memphis Lambuth Campus are located approximately 30+/- minutes to the South. Healthcare facilities are present in both Martin Tennessee, and Milan Tennessee, both within a 20 +/- min commute.
Bradford, TN is a small rural town with a friendly atmosphere, low crime rate, fiscally responsible government, and well ran school system. Bradford has its own special school district with a locally elected school board, its own police, and fire department. A bank, grocery store, and restaurant can all be found downtown. The population according to the 2020 census is just under 1,000 residents. Bradford is located in Gibson County, Tennessee on US Highway 45E. The town proudly boasts its claim to fame as the “Doodle Soup Capital of the World,” hosting an annual festival in that honor.
